Colombia fixes moorland boundaries affecting gold miners

BOGOTA, Dec 19 (Reuters) - Colombia's Environment Ministry announced it had fixed the boundaries of an ecologically delicate moorland in the country's northeast, a decision that would affect two of three miners with a license to explore or develop mining there.
